For sixty miles of this voyage, between Lochae and Pentan, the sea in many places is only four fathoms deep Thirty miles to the south-east from Pentan, is the island and kingdom of Malaiur , which has a king and a peculiar language of its own, and has a great trade carried on in spices from Pentan.
From the Trevigi edition Pinkerton calls this Malonir, and curiously identifies Pepetam, Pentara, or Pentan, as the name of the city and kingdom of Malonir or Malaiur. If right in our former conjectures, the island spoken of in the text must be Sumatra not that now called Java.
